Title:
MECHANISM OF THERMAL DECOMPOSITION OF HMX (1,3,5,7-TETRANITRO-1,3,5,7-TETRAZACYCLOOCTANE),

Abstract:
The basic mechanisms by which certain substances can undergo explosive decomposition are not well understood. No generalized models are available to explain the mechanism of explosion in terms of primary electronic and molecular processes. One useful approach has been to study the slow decomposition of metastable materials induced by various stimuli such as heat, light and ionizing radiation. Knowledge concerning these processes such as rate constants and identity of the reactive intermediates, should be helpful for a mechanistic understanding of the fast reactions in explosives. Author
